A traffic collision involving two vehicles occurred today at the intersection of North Goldenrod Avenue and West Belmont Avenue in Kerman, CA. The incident was reported at approximately 4:58 PM and resulted in significant disruptions to traffic flow in the area.
Emergency response units arrived on the scene to manage traffic and ensure safety. The vehicles involved included a sedan, which sustained major damage. Debris from the collision was also present, further complicating the traffic situation.
As emergency personnel worked to clear the scene, motorists experienced delays and backups in both directions, particularly during the busy late afternoon hours. The traffic incident created challenges for drivers navigating through this intersection, leading to extended travel times for those in the vicinity.
By 5:33 PM, emergency responders had begun directing traffic to alleviate congestion while they worked to clear the roadway. The scene was eventually cleared, but drivers were advised to remain cautious and expect residual delays as traffic returned to normal.
